Output 659d50005b5aae576c09aed9f35393fc72f7e5c6236a54fb4e73e4ac1e87b004:3

value
98863615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ec3c006a88735c522e011da6218bc57c4215620e OP_EQUAL
address
3PE7GoTPVmL16J2yMuH5sRhJfhPoy5jEEy
transaction
659d50005b5aae576c09aed9f35393fc72f7e5c6236a54fb4e73e4ac1e87b004
spent
true